Conditions

shoulder pain

Interventions

Ultrasound guided group:Ultrasound guided shock wave therapy+conventional rehabilitation therapy
Pain point localization group:Pain point localization shock wave therapy+conventional rehabilitation therapy

Inclusion criteria

Inclusion criteria: 1. Shoulder pain patients (adhesive capsulitis, rotator cuff injury, acromion impingement syndrome, hemiplegic shoulder pain, shoulder pain after spinal cord injury, etc.); 2. First onset of illness; 3. Disease duration <= 6 months; 4. Agree to sign the informed consent form; 5. Approved by the Ethics Committee of Xuzhou Rehabilitation Hospital.

Exclusion criteria

Exclusion criteria: 1. History of other chronic pain and mental illnesses; 2. Severe liver and kidney dysfunction, poor cardiopulmonary function; 3. Infection of the affected shoulder; 4. Platelet and coagulation dysfunction; 5. Those with poor compliance and inability to cooperate.

Design outcomes

Primary

MeasureTime frame
Visual Analog Scale (VAS);

Secondary

MeasureTime frame
shoulder pain and disability index(SPADI);Passive range of motion of shoulder joint;Ultrasound imaging evaluation;Constant Murley shoulder joint functional assessment;
